Everyone knew Fowley was a total dirtbag but this is really the cherry on top, no pun intended.  I worked with the Runaways at The Whisky three separate bookings in '77 and  mainly dealt with Kent Smythe, their road manager mentioned in the article.  He held them in utter contempt.  Cherie Curry quit during sound check for the last gigs and Joan Jett just picked up the ball and ran with it.

After one of the Friday night shows I was sitting on the backstage stairs shooting the shit with Smythe.  Elvis Costello came barreling up the stairs on his way to their dressing room.  As he passed us Kent said to him, "They're definitely NOT 'This Year's Model'."  Didn't faze Elvis.
